MSFT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

4,808 of the 6,371 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Microsoft (MSFT)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$1.79T — up 18% from $1.52T a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 220 funds opened new MSFT posit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 138 holders — while 1,778 added to existing stakes and 2,492 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$5.77B. The largest seller was OFI Invest Asset Management, cutting an estimated $76B.
